Chapter 277 The Village without Burials

There are many elderly people in the village.

There were more than twenty people, all with pale beards and hair, and rough faces. They were all at least sixty years old. These old people looked directly at the family members, with a kind of horror in their eyes.

It's just like…

Looking at a bunch of dead people!

This strange look made everyone feel a little scared.

Wu Xian glanced around and looked at each one one by one. He saw that some of the old people had hunchbacks, some had cloudy eyes, and some were coughing. All of them looked like they were about to die soon.

These old people in charge should be... Wu Xian's eyes fell on a lame old man.

Although this old man is lame, his body is very strong. He is wearing a dirty long gown, holding a blackened wooden walking stick with one hand, and holding a yellowed jade-mouthed wooden pipe in his mouth. His short hair is all white. , with sharp eyes.

The house the old man walked out of was the largest in the village. It was an ancient-style wooden building. The oil paper on the windows was half torn, and most of the red paint had peeled off. There were still two lines of couplet-like words engraved on the door, but the writing was mottled. Hard to identify.

Wu Xian smiled and waved to the old man, but the old man ignored Wu Xian and just looked at Wen Chao, the eldest in the team. This old man didn't seem to like young people very much.

After Wen Chao noticed it, he walked over and said hello.

"Brother, what's your surname?"

Facing Wen Chao, who is also an old man, the old man's attitude became much better: "My surname is Tang. Tang Guangyun is the village guard here. You can just call me Old Tang."

"Brother Tang, we are a scientific expedition team. We encountered something last night and ended up in your place. May I ask where this is..."

Old Tang hesitated for two seconds, then sighed and said, "This is the Burialless Village."

Wen Chao was stunned for a moment. This village name was worth studying, but not now, so he continued to ask.

"We are new to your place, and we don't know the local customs and taboos. Brother, can you tell us? It's best to find a place to rest, as long as it can be sheltered from the wind and rain..."

Old Tang glanced at the number of newlyweds' dependents.

He turned back to the house and walked out a moment later with a small package containing all his belongings.

"I'm going to live with Lao Zhao in that house. There are many of you, so this spacious house will be yours. As for customs and taboos, we will be neighbors from now on. We have plenty of time to chat slowly."

Old Tang said and walked aside.

Wu Xian stood in front of him and asked.

"You said we will be neighbors from now on, do you mean we will live here for a long time?"

Old Tang turned around and looked at the coffins and urns.

"Unburied Village is a place for people waiting to die. You young people don't belong here, but since you have been in coffins and urns, you are also people waiting to die. This is our destination."

After saying this, Old Tang walked away from Wu Xian.

Wu Xian was slightly stunned. Old Tang looked at him with complicated eyes just now.

It seems to be pity, but it also seems to be ridicule.

After Old Tang left, the old people watching on the side all returned to their rooms as if they had received some instructions.

Not long after.

The only people left in the village were the new couple and a dog.

The cold wind blew up some sand and dust, and there was an indescribable feeling of desolation.

Through the conversation just now.

Wu Xian determined that the mission location of this blessed land was the Burialless Village. Although there are still many mysteries that have not yet been solved, the top priority now is to settle down. Wu Xian had many things to think about, so he was the first to walk into the room.

As soon as Wu Xian entered the house, he smelled a strong smell.

There was the musty smell that had not been cleaned for a long time, and the rotten smell of a dying old man.

The colors on the floor are wonderful.

Yellow, black, and different shades of blood stains. Old Tang must have been the only one who lived here. The small package on Old Tang's body also showed this. It shouldn't have been too long since he came to Burial Village.

Wu Xian found a relatively clean place, took off a coat and sat down.

The benefit of wearing more clothes came to light at this time. There was still a coat under his coat. After sitting down, Wu Xian began to review what he had seen and heard since entering the blessed land until now.

"Burialless Village..."

"It literally means a village without funerals, so why are so many coffins and urns delivered?"

"Old Tang said that we are people waiting to die. It seems that the act of entering the coffin has indeed brought some negative effects to us, but that is the only way to survive. This is the only way we can go."

Wu Xian looked at the other dependents and newcomers.

"The danger last night was a bit extreme. The only way to survive would lead us here, and so far not even a single dead person has appeared."

"Perhaps last night until I pushed open the coffin lid this morning was just the foreplay of this blessed land. The real blessed land only begins now!"

Then Wu Xian opened the family member's ultimatum.

Time was too tight last night and the light was too dark, so he had no chance to read the guidance of the family member's ultimatum until now.

'Life is death, death is life. It comes from the coffin and must go from the coffin. This world has lost its 'funeral'. Please hold a complete funeral for yourself. The correct way to die is the only way to escape from this blessed place. …'

After reading this explanation.

Wu Xian's brows knitted together and he almost wanted to curse.

You must die to escape. This blessed land will not give the dependents a way to survive?

But Wu Xian immediately realized that this passage was actually a very clear guideline. The so-called funeral was definitely not as simple as burying a person in a pit, but some kind of complex ceremony. Only after completing the ceremony and lying in the coffin could one proceed from there. Leave this blessed place.

In addition, this blessed land is different from the previous blessed land.

The previous mission of the blessed land belonged to everyone, and everyone could leave together after completing a certain goal. But this time everyone has to prepare a funeral for themselves, so everyone's mission is separate. As long as they are capable enough, they can even throw others away. Leave early by yourself.

"No wonder this place is called Burial-Free Village. I'm afraid it's incredibly difficult to hold a proper funeral."

Thoughts over.

Wu Xian shared what he saw in the ultimatum with the newcomers who did not have the ultimatum. They at least had the right to know how to leave this blessed place.

Then everyone briefly exchanged information, their own findings and ideas, and then dispersed.

Daytime hours are relatively safe.

There were many things they had to do, such as exploring the environment and searching for food and water sources. Old Tang only gave them a place to live, but did not provide them with food or drink at all.

In addition, they must try their best to communicate with those old men and women in order to obtain more information and prepare for possible dangers at night.

What Wu Xian wants to figure out most at this moment is.

What is the right funeral?
